Section 1
That the Senate— affirms that the Islamic Republic of Iran’s continued pursuit of a nuclear weapons capability is— a credible threat to the United States; and an existential threat to Israel and other allies and partners in the Middle East; asserts all options should be considered to address the nuclear threat the Islamic Republic of Iran poses to the United States, Israel, and our allies and partners; demands the Islamic Republic of Iran to immediately cease engaging in any and all activities that threaten the national security interests of the United States, Israel, and our allies and partners, including— enriching uranium; developing or possessing delivery vehicles capable of carrying nuclear warheads; and developing or possessing a nuclear warhead.
Section 2
1. Rule of construction Nothing in this resolution may be construed to authorize the use of military force or the introduction of United States Armed Forces into hostilities.
